Job Description

Our math assessment team is responsible for ensuring Star Assessments continue to provide teachers and administrators with actionable insight into each student’s math skills. As a member of this team, you will collaborate with dedicated and experienced content developers to author new assessment content for customers, maintain state learning progressions, and use your pedagogical expertise to drive content improvements within a fast-paced production environment.

In this role, you will: 

  • Design and develop high quality assessment content using subject matter expertise, Renaissance content guidelines, and state educational standards 
  • Develop Renaissance content guidelines using subject matter expertise and knowledge of Renaissance products 
  • Build and improve processes and procedures using expertise in assessment content development 
  • Give and receive feedback to improve the development of assessment content 
  • Evaluate data for accuracy and make data driven decisions 
  • Use department software for data management, data analysis, and content development

Qualifications

For this role, you must have: 

  • Full biliteracy in English and Spanish 
  • 3+ years of educational content development or classroom experience in a primary (K-2) school setting 
  • Bachelor’s from an accredited university 
  • Equivalent combination of education and experience 

Bonus points for: 

  • Bachelor’s in mathematics 
  • Proficient level of knowledge of Renaissance products
